Key Elements of a Good Jersey Design Mockup

When searching for jersey design mockups, not all are created equal. A good mockup should have several key elements to ensure it meets your needs and helps you create the best possible design. Let's take a closer look at what those elements are.

First and foremost, high resolution is crucial. A high-resolution mockup will allow you to zoom in and see the details of your design without any pixelation or blurring. This is especially important for showcasing intricate patterns, logos, or text. Look for mockups that are at least 300 DPI (dots per inch) to ensure that your design looks crisp and clear. A low-resolution mockup can make your design look unprofessional and may not accurately represent the final product.

Secondly, realistic textures and lighting are essential for creating a believable representation of the jersey. The mockup should accurately simulate the way light interacts with the fabric, creating realistic shadows and highlights. The texture of the fabric should also be accurately represented, whether it's a smooth, shiny material or a rough, textured one. This level of detail can make a huge difference in how your design is perceived. Realistic textures and lighting can help your design stand out and make it look more appealing.

Thirdly, easy customization is a must-have feature. You should be able to easily change the colors, add your own graphics, and adjust the placement of design elements. Look for mockups that use smart objects in Photoshop, which allow you to easily replace the existing design with your own. The mockup should also be well-organized, with clearly labeled layers that make it easy to find and edit specific elements. A mockup that is difficult to customize can be frustrating to use and may not allow you to achieve the desired result.

In addition to these key elements, a good mockup should also offer multiple views of the jersey. This could include front, back, and side views, as well as close-ups of specific areas, such as the collar or sleeves. Multiple views allow you to showcase your design from different angles and provide a more comprehensive representation of the final product. This can be especially useful for presenting your design to clients or stakeholders. Also, consider mockups that offer different jersey styles, such as short-sleeved, long-sleeved, or sleeveless, to suit your specific needs.

Where to Find Free Jersey Design Mockups

Alright, guys, let's get to the good stuff! Finding high-quality jersey design mockups for free can sometimes feel like searching for a needle in a haystack. But don't worry, I've got you covered. Here are some fantastic resources where you can find free mockups to elevate your design game.

1. Freepik: Freepik is a goldmine for designers. It offers a wide variety of free jersey mockup PSDs, ranging from sports jerseys to esports apparel. The quality is generally high, and you can find mockups that cater to different styles and sports. Just be sure to check the license before using any mockup, as some may require attribution.

2. Pixeden: Pixeden offers both free and premium design resources. Their free section includes a selection of jersey mockups that are well-designed and easy to use. The mockups often come with smart object layers, making it simple to insert your own designs. Pixeden is a great option if you're looking for professional-quality mockups without spending any money.

3. Behance: Behance is a platform where designers showcase their work, and many of them offer free resources, including jersey mockups. You might need to do some digging, but you can often find unique and high-quality mockups that you won't find anywhere else. Plus, you'll be supporting the design community by using their free resources.

4. Dribbble: Similar to Behance, Dribbble is a great place to discover designers and their free resources. Many designers offer free mockups as a way to promote their work and gain exposure. Keep an eye out for jersey mockups that catch your eye, and be sure to follow the designer if you like their style.

5. GraphicBurger: GraphicBurger is another fantastic resource for free design mockups. They offer a variety of high-quality jersey mockups that are easy to customize and use in your projects. The mockups are often well-organized and come with detailed instructions, making them suitable for both beginners and experienced designers.

6. PSD Repo: PSD Repo is a website that curates free PSD files from around the web. You can find a wide variety of jersey mockups on PSD Repo, ranging from simple to more complex designs. The website is easy to navigate, and you can quickly find the mockups you need.

When using free mockups, always double-check the license to ensure that you're allowed to use them for your specific purpose. Some mockups may only be free for personal use, while others may be free for commercial use with attribution. It's always better to be safe than sorry!

Tips for Customizing Your Jersey Mockup

Okay, so you've found the perfect jersey design mockup. Now what? Customizing your mockup is where the magic happens. Here are some tips to help you create a standout design that will impress your clients and make your team proud.

First, start with a clear vision. Before you even open Photoshop, take some time to brainstorm and sketch out your ideas. What colors do you want to use? What logos or graphics will you include? Where will you place them on the jersey? Having a clear vision will help you stay focused and make the customization process much smoother. Consider the overall aesthetic you're trying to achieve. Are you going for a modern, minimalist look or a bold, eye-catching design?

Next, pay attention to color. Color is one of the most important elements of any design, and it's crucial to choose colors that complement each other and reflect the personality of your team or brand. Use a color palette generator to find harmonious color combinations, or take inspiration from existing designs that you admire. When customizing your mockup, experiment with different color options to see what works best. Don't be afraid to try unexpected combinations, but always make sure that the colors are visually appealing and easy on the eyes.

Another important tip is to use high-quality graphics. Low-resolution logos and images will look blurry and unprofessional on your jersey. Make sure that all of your graphics are at least 300 DPI and that they are properly sized for the mockup. If you're using vector graphics, such as logos or illustrations, scale them up or down as needed without losing any quality. High-quality graphics will make your design look polished and professional.

Moreover, experiment with different fonts. The font you choose for your team name, player numbers, and other text elements can have a big impact on the overall look of your jersey. Choose a font that is easy to read and that complements the rest of your design. Don't be afraid to try different fonts until you find one that you love. However, avoid using too many different fonts, as this can make your design look cluttered and confusing. Stick to one or two fonts for a clean, cohesive look.

Finally, don't be afraid to get creative. The best jersey designs are often those that break the mold and try something new. Experiment with different patterns, textures, and design elements to create a unique and memorable jersey. Just make sure that your design is still functional and easy to wear. A jersey that looks great but is uncomfortable or impractical is not a good jersey.
